Hugh Dickson Trophy
Friday 5th April
The Hugh Dickson Trophy, is a competition played annually between former and current members of Glasgow Golf Club Council (Captain’s Committee & Board). Hugh Dickson was Captain in 1947 & 1948, Champion in 1935, Captained Scotland and was President of the Scottish Golf Union.

Unfortunately heavy rain throughout the day, ahead of the arrival of Storm Kathleen, forced the closure of the course. Disappointed but relieved that the heavy rain had tipped the decision in favour of abandonment, we gathered for Dinner in the evening.
The traditional ‘Black Tie’ Dinner, in honour of the immediate past Captain is held in the evening, this year we honoured Donald Neilson.

The Past Captain, like the holder of The Masters, has the choice of food at his Dinner. Needless to say Fish was on the menu.

Captain Peter’s light hearted speech highlighted PC Donald’s numerous achievements on and off the course, in his year of office.

A lovely occasion for Donald, especially to share his moment with father and Past Captain Bobby Neilson (1988). We took a moment together in silence, in respect of Bobby’s good friend and well respected Past Captain Jack Halley (1987), who sadly recently passed.
